How DECLARE variable and assign value in SQL?
Variables in SQL procedures are defined by using the DECLARE statement. Values can be assigned to variables using the SET statement or the SELECT INTO statement or as a default value when the variable is declared. Literals, expressions, the result of a query, and special register values can be assigned to variables.
How do you assign a variable in SQL Server?
To assign a value to a variable, use the SET statement. This is the preferred method of assigning a value to a variable. A variable can also have a value assigned by being referenced in the select list of a SELECT statement.
How do I assign a SQL query result to a variable?
The syntax for assigning a value to a SQL variable within a SELECT query is @ var_name := value , where var_name is the variable name and value is a value that you’re retrieving. The variable may be used in subsequent queries wherever an expression is allowed, such as in a WHERE clause or in an INSERT statement.
How do you DECLARE a local variable in SQL?
By default, DECLARE initializes variable to NULL. Using the keyword ‘AS’ is optional. To declare more than one local variable, use a comma after the first local variable definition, and then define the next local variable name and data type.
Which statement is used to assign a value to a variable?
The simple assignment operator ( = ) is used to assign a value to a variable.
How do you assign a value to a variable in SQL?
Assigning a value to a VARIABLE . You can assign a value to a variable in the following three ways: During variable declaration using DECLARE keyword. Using SET; Using SELECT; Let’s have a look at all three ways in detail: During variable declaration using DECLARE keyword. T-SQL Syntax: DECLARE { @Local_Variable [AS] Datatype [ = value ] }
How to create a new SQL variable using declare?
This new feature enables SQL programmers to create a new sql variable using DECLARE command and directly assign it to a value using “=” (equal) sign in the same statement. In-line variable declaration and value assignment enables developers to code less and makes it easier to read the SQL code.
How many local variables can be declared in SQL?
We can declare as many local variables that we require in SQL and specify their datatypes and initialize and assign values to those variables using DECLARE, SET, and SELECT statements as demonstrated in the above examples.
How to declare a variable in a table-valued function?
In SQL Server you can’t declare variables inside of an inline table-Valued function. You’ll need to create a multi-statement table valued function if you really need to declare variables in it.